Submitted by: @paulvink
Charset names KOI8-R and KOI8-U in the 2.0 and 2.1 Rlsnotes should in fact be KOI8R and KOI8U.
Dictonary collations for these sets are KOI8R_RU and KOI8U_UA (table in Appx B, 2.1 Notes).
Also in that table: the case-ins. Czech collation for WIN1250 is called WIN_CZ, not WIN_CZ_CI (at least in 2.0!)
